Justin Bieber's Team Threatens Legal Action Over Bora Bora Photos
Justin Bieber‘s team went right to work to threaten legal action against sites that posted the racy photos of the singer snapped during his vacation in Bora Bora.
The 21-year-old singer’s lawyers sent the New York Daily News a cease and desist letter and demanded that the photos be removed from the website within 12 hours of receipt, though they are still live on the site well after the time limit.

“We recently became informed that your company has obtained and is distributing unauthorized photographs of our Client including images showing him without clothing,” the letter read (via THR).
Justin‘s team is threatening to sue if the photos are not removed from the site as they are a violation of his publicity and privacy rights, as well as an infringement on his trademark.
